Job Role / Duties:

  • Operate machinery and equipment safely and efficiently.
  • Assemble automotive components following company guidelines and quality standards.
  • Conduct quality checks to ensure all parts meet required specifications.
  • Follow safety protocols and maintain a clean work environment.
  • Meet production targets and deadlines while maintaining accuracy.
  • Work collaboratively with team members and supervisors.
  • Report any equipment malfunctions or production issues to management.

Shifts Salary: Starting at £28,394 per annum working 37.5hrs from Monday to Friday. Variable shift patterns which may include: 7am To 3pm, 4:30pm To 1am.

How to prepare for a job interview at CastleView Group

Know Your Machinery

Familiarise yourself with the types of machinery and equipment you'll be operating. Research common safety protocols and operational guidelines to show that you’re proactive and ready to hit the ground running.

Quality is Key

Understand the importance of quality checks in the manufacturing process. Be prepared to discuss how you’ve ensured quality in previous roles, and think of examples where you’ve identified and resolved issues before they became problems.

Teamwork Makes the Dream Work

Since collaboration is crucial in this role, think of times when you’ve worked effectively in a team. Be ready to share specific examples that highlight your ability to communicate and support your colleagues.

Stay Calm Under Pressure

Manufacturing can be fast-paced, so prepare to discuss how you handle stress and meet production targets. Share strategies you use to maintain accuracy while working efficiently, and don’t forget to mention any experience with tight deadlines.
